Ionic Gels and Their Applications in Stretchable Electronics.

Sign Up to like & get
recommendations!
Published in 2018 at "Macromolecular rapid communications"

DOI: 10.1002/marc.201800246

Abstract: Ionic gels represent a novel class of stretchable materials where ionic conducting liquid is immobilized in a polymer matrix. This review focuses on the design of ionic gel materials and device fabrication of ionic-gel-based stretchable… read more here.
